Does Polycarbonate Greenhouse Turn Yellow in the Sun?

Jul. 19, 2025

Polycarbonate is one of the most popular materials for greenhouse construction due to its light transmission, impact resistance, and thermal insulation. However, many greenhouse owners and buyers worry about one crucial question:


Does a polycarbonate greenhouse turn yellow when exposed to sunlight over time?


In this article, we explore the science behind polycarbonate yellowing, what causes it, how modern UV protection technology helps prevent it, and how you can choose the best panels to ensure long-term durability for your greenhouse investment.

3. UV-Coated Polycarbonate Panels: The Game Changer


Modern polycarbonate sheets come with UV-resistant coatings, which significantly extend their lifespan. There are typically two types:



These coatings block 99.9% of harmful UV radiation, preventing yellowing and preserving clarity for 10+ years under normal outdoor conditions.


Tip: Always confirm if your greenhouse panels have co-extruded UV protection. Cheaper panels without this feature will yellow quickly.

7. When Should You Replace Yellowed Panels?


If you notice:


…it may be time to replace your panels. Usually, well-maintained, UV-protected polycarbonate lasts 10–15 years before needing replacement.


8. Final Answer: Do Polycarbonate Greenhouses Turn Yellow in the Sun?


Yes, they canbut only if the polycarbonate is uncoated or low quality.


With proper UV protection and regular care, high-grade polycarbonate greenhouse panels will stay clear and functional for over a decade.
